Assists one or more workers in the skilled maintenance trades by performing specific or general duties of lesser skill, such as keeping a worker supplied with materials and tools; cleaning work area, machine, and equipment; assisting journey‑level worker by holding materials or tools; and performing other unskilled tasks as directed by a craftsperson or parts of a trade that are also performed by workers on a full‑time basis. The kind of work the helper is permitted to perform varies from trade to trade. In some trades the helper is confined to supplying, lifting, holding materials and tools, and cleaning working areas. In others, they are permitted to perform specialized machine operations. Performs other duties as assigned.
